The Infineon BTS409L1 E3062A is a single-channel PROFET high-side power switch — it connects a 5 V to 34 V load to the supply rail under logic control, with integrated protection that saves board space. The 160 mOhm typical Rds(on) sets the conduction loss floor: at 1.8 A the dissipation is about 0.5 W, which the PG-TO263-5-2 package's exposed tab sinks to the board copper.

The 160 mOhm typical on-resistance is the value at 25°C junction; expect it to roughly double at 150°C junction. If the load draws 1.8 A continuously, the I²R loss at temperature could reach 1 W — that copper area on the PG-TO263-5-2 tab needs to be generous. The part includes over-temperature shutdown, so a marginal heatsink causes cycling rather than immediate failure, but the thermal pad layout should still follow the datasheet's recommended footprint.

Is BTS409L1 E3062A obsolete?

Yes, the BTS409L1 E3062A is listed as Obsolete. Infineon no longer manufactures it, and no direct replacement order code is provided. Sourcing is through independent distribution against an RFQ.

What is the Rds(on) of BTS409L1?

The typical Rds(on) is 160 mOhm. This is the on-resistance at 25°C junction; expect it to increase with temperature, roughly doubling at the 150°C maximum junction temperature.
